Critics have leveled many accusations against the leaders of the Watchtower Jehovah's Witnesses, accusing them of being soft on pedophiles-of being false prophets and of ruining families. But how do we know what Jehovah himself thinks of the organization that bears his name? The answers are in the Bible. Robert King offers a unique interpretation of God's judgments in scripture, comparing modern-day Jehovah's Witnesses to the people of Jerusalem in ancient times who came under God's judgment. This prophetic book does more than expose the errors and hypocrisy of the Watchtower's leadership; it serves as a revelation of God's judgments on the people who bear his name. Jehovah Himself Has Become King is a must-read for both devout Jehovah's Witnesses and those who are questioning their faith. This revised third edition includes new indexes and updates on current problems facing the church, making it a definitive reference guide.

THE KINGDOM OF GOD HAS COME In the Lord’s Prayer, we acknowledge that our Heavenly Father’s name is holy. We pray for his will to be done on earth as it is in heaven. Jehovah, our Heavenly Father, is establishing righteousness here on earth, reflecting that in heaven. He has sent his Son, Jesus Christ, to bring true justice for those who walk in God’s ways: the end of cruelty and suffering, the restoration of the earth, and the resurrection of our loved ones. This is also the Day of Reckoning for all people. Jehovah’s Witnesses call themselves by God’s holy name. Therefore, Jehovah himself has measured their teachings and conduct. Those taking the lead are responsible for shepherding God’s people with tenderness and compassion, as Jesus would. Instead, they manipulate the holy scriptures to control people. They also seek material and political security instead of looking to God. In doing these things, they forsake righteousness and deny their faith. They have broken their covenant relationship with Jehovah. Consequently, “their light is no more.” Jeremiah 4:23-31
